Design and Size
The Apple Watch Series 11 maintains its traditional slim lightweight square design while introducing 42mm and 46mm size options which accommodate different wrist measurements. The aluminum or stainless steel case structure offers enhanced protection through its 50m water resistance capacity which enables it to withstand both swimming and outdoor activities. The product weighs between 30 and 40 grams depending on the version which enables users to wear it comfortably throughout the day without experiencing wrist discomfort.
The Series 11 watch presents a modern design through its thinner bezel which enhances the watch face display. The small change works best for women and for users who want basic design elements with attractive visual appeal. The Apple Watch Series 11 maintains its design through existing elements while providing users with durable performance options which enable them to wear the watch comfortably throughout their active day.
Display and Display Quality
The Apple Watch Series 11 uses a Retina LTPO OLED display which reaches 2000 nits of brightness to enhance outdoor visibility through its enhanced display capabilities. The two size options, 42mm and 46mm, offer ample display space, combined with thin bezels to ensure clear visibility of information such as maps, notifications, and health data. The Always-On feature maintains its function because optimized LTPO technology now delivers better energy efficiency.
The Series 11 displays exceptional image quality through its bright colors and deep contrasts which enable users to watch short videos and monitor their health activities. The screen demonstrates improved resistance against direct sunlight because users can view time and information without needing to block their face. This advantage benefits people who travel frequently and participate in outdoor sports.
Straps and Compatibility
The Apple Watch Series 11 provides multiple strap choices which include athletic silicone straps and high-end leather straps that feature a quick-release system for fast strap replacements. The Sport Loop and Milanese Loop versions deliver a comfortable fit that active users can easily maintain through cleaning after exercise sessions.
The Series 11 establishes a connection with iPhones that use iOS 18 or newer versions which enables users to synchronize their data through the Health application. The watch supports 5G RedCap for fast data transfer with reasonable battery consumption, along with Bluetooth 5.3 and Wi-Fi, enabling calls, online music streaming, and notification management without needing an iPhone nearby. Users who operate Android devices can currently not access direct support yet they can experience good compatibility through the Apple ecosystem which works with devices like AirPods and HomePod.
Software and Other Features
The Apple Watch Series 11 operates on watchOS 26 which provides users with a user-friendly interface that contains customizable widgets and Apple Intelligence features that display intelligent suggestions based on user habits. The primary health features of the system include sleep monitoring, 30-minute SpO₂ blood oxygen level measurement, electrocardiogram (ECG), fall detection, and menstrual cycle tracking. The hypertension alert system has become more advanced through its use of machine learning algorithms which detect early signs of abnormal hypertension.
The S10 chip maintains constant performance while executing two tasks which include exact GPS tracking and simultaneous analysis of workout data. Users can select from hundreds of watch face designs which range from basic to advanced. The Series 11 operates as a dependable medical assistant because its software can adapt to user needs and its extensive cardiovascular health monitoring functions.
Battery Life and Charging
The Series 11 introduces a 24-hour battery life which surpasses the 18 hours of the Series 10 because the S10 chip delivers better power management and 5G modem technology uses less energy. The battery provides sufficient power to last an entire workday while continuously monitoring heart rate and sending alerts and even has excess energy available for the rest of the night. The fast charging system enables the device to reach 80 percent battery capacity within 30 minutes through its magnetic charger which provides a practical solution for people who work without rest.
People who use Always-On or GPS functions continuously will experience battery life drops which require them to recharge their devices before reaching 20-hour power limits. Users who perform resource-intensive activities will find this device unsuitable because it has shorter operating time than competing watches such as the Galaxy Watch 7 which offers 48 hours of battery power. People who need their devices to function for extended periods should consider this as an important point.
Apple Watch Series 11 Specifications Table
For the most comprehensive overview here is a summary table of the key specifications of the Apple Watch Series 11 which helps you quickly grasp the core elements before deciding to buy.
| Size | 42mm and 46mm |
| Display | Retina LTPO OLED, 2,000 nits brightness |
| Processor | S10 SiP |
| Connectivity | 5G RedCap, Bluetooth 5.3, Wi-Fi |
| Health Tracking | SpO₂ (blood oxygen after 30 minutes), ECG, blood pressure monitoring |
| Water Resistance | 50m |
| Battery Life | Up to 24 hours |
| Operating System | watchOS 26 |
